Heim  >  Artikel  >  Was sind unäre Operatoren und binäre Operatoren?

Was sind unäre Operatoren und binäre Operatoren?

藏色散人
藏色散人Original
2019-06-04 10:12:5740142Durchsuche

Was sind unäre Operatoren und binäre Operatoren?

Was ist ein unärer Operator?

Unärer Operator bezieht sich auf einen Operator, der eine Variable für die Operation benötigt, das heißt, es gibt nur einen Operanden in der Operation, auch unärer Operator genannt, unter denen es logische NICHT-Operatoren gibt: !, drücken Bit-Negationsoperator: ~, Inkrement- und Dekrementoperator: ++, -- usw.

Logischer NICHT-Operator [!], bitweiser Negationsoperator [~], Inkrementierungs- und Dekrementierungsoperator [++, --], Negativvorzeichenoperator [-], Typkonvertierungsoperator [(Typ)], Zeigeroperator und Adressoperator [* und &], Längenoperator [sizeof]

Was ist ein binärer Operator?

Ein Operator, der zwei Variablen für die Operation benötigt, wird als binärer Operator bezeichnet, oder ein Operator, der erfordert, dass die Anzahl der Operanden 2 beträgt, wird als binärer Operator bezeichnet.

Elementaroperator 

Indexoperator [[]], Komponentenoperator, der auf Strukturelementoperator zeigt [->], Strukturelementoperationssymbole [.]

Arithmetische Operatoren

Multiplikationsoperator [*], Divisionsoperator [/], Restoperator [%], Additionsoperator [+], Subtraktionsoperator [-]

Vergleichsoperator

Gleichheitsoperator [==], Ungleichheitsoperator [!=], Vergleichsoperator Symbole【<= >= 】

Logischer Operator

Logischer UND-Operator【&&】, Logischer ODER-Operator【||】, logischer NICHT-Operator [! 】

Bitweise Operatoren

Bitweiser UND-Operator [&], Bitweiser XOR-Operator [^], Bitweiser ODER-Operator [|], Linksverschiebungsoperator [<< ], Rechtsverschiebungsoperator [>>]

Zuweisungsoperator

Zuweisungsoperator [= += - = *= /= %= >>= <<= &= |= ^=】

Kommaoperator

Kommaoperator【, 】

Das obige ist der detaillierte Inhalt vonWas sind unäre Operatoren und binäre Operatoren?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n